Nyandarua woman seeks help to cure mysterious swelling on her stomach.
Kezia Nyambura Macharia, a 41-year-old mother of three in Kipipiri Constituency, Nyandarua County, is appealing for well-wishers’ support to undergo an operation at Kenya National Hospital to cure a strange swelling on her stomach.
The swelling, she says, started as a small bulging of the stomach which she thought was pregnancy, but the bulging continued increasing forcing her to visit several hospitals without getting a solution.
Since 2019, Nyambura has been walking with difficulty because the swollen stomach has become too heavy to carry.
The mother of three, who lives in Kiambogo village had an ultrasound done on her at the JM Kariuki Memorial Hospital in Ol Kalou but the procedure did not detect anything.

She was advised to go to Nakuru PGH hospital to undergo a CT scan and it is here that she was told the swelling is emanating from the uterus and that she has to undergo surgery to remove it.
The swelling has even interrupted her sleep as every 10 minutes, she has to wake up, stand up then turn.
She hopes Kenyans of good will can help her go to Kenyatta National Hospital for treatment as soon as possible.
Her children who are in form two, grade eight and grade six respectively are taken care of by their grandmother who is unable to keep them in school uninterrupted. The children are always being sent home because of school fees arrears.
